Anyone know what a proper seed URL is for this? I've tried using htt://[host]:[port]/wps/wcm/myconnect/[path] to no avail. And, after the fixpack is installed for 6.0.0.1, the WebContentCollection is gone (and can't be recreated). Thanks in advance.

2007-02-24, 7:17 pm

The WCM content source and seed url are generated for you when you edit a Site, set the site to be searchable, identify the collection, set the userid and password and save the Site.

Thanks for your reply. The problem I was having was that the URL information was not being populated automatically. This was because the site wasn't set to be searchable. When you make a site searchable, you actually configure the collection that the s
ite is searchable within.

In order to setup the Managed Web Content search you have to create a collection in the Administration area without the Managed Web Content content source. Then you have to go to the WCM Authoring Portlet, make your site searchable, and configure the col
lection that it's searchable from.

You're also limited to a single collection per WCM site. The interface is a little misleading in that regard since you can add multiple content sources. If you want to search two Managed Web Content sites, you have to setup two different collections and
roll them into a service that your search will use.
